0
Your cart

Your cart is empty

Browse All Departments
  • All Departments
Price
  • R1,000 - R2,500 (1)
  • -
Status
Brand

Showing 1 - 1 of 1 matches in All Departments

Mastering C# Concurrency (Paperback): Eugene Agafonov, Andrew Koryavchenko Mastering C# Concurrency (Paperback)
Eugene Agafonov, Andrew Koryavchenko
R1,377 Discovery Miles 13 770 Ships in 18 - 22 working days

Create robust and scalable applications along with responsive UI using concurrency and the multi-threading infrastructure in .NET and C# About This Book * Learn to combine your asynchronous operations with Task Parallel Library * Master C#'s asynchronous infrastructure and use asynchronous APIs effectively to achieve optimal responsiveness of the application * An easy-to-follow, example-based guide that helps you to build scalable applications using concurrency in C# Who This Book Is For If you are a C# developer who wants to develop modern applications in C# and wants to overcome problems by using asynchronous APIs and standard patterns, then this book is ideal for you. Reasonable development knowledge, an understanding of core elements and applications related to the .Net platform, and also the fundamentals of concurrency is assumed. What You Will Learn * Apply general multithreading concepts to your application's design * Leverage lock-free concurrency and learn about its pros and cons to achieve efficient synchronization between user threads * Combine your asynchronous operations with Task Parallel Library * Make your code easier with C#'s asynchrony support * Use common concurrent collections and programming patterns * Write scalable and robust server-side asynchronous code * Create fast and responsible client applications * Avoid common problems and troubleshoot your multi-threaded and asynchronous applications In Detail Starting with the traditional approach to concurrency, you will learn how to write multithreaded concurrent programs and compose ways that won't require locking. You will explore the concepts of parallelism granularity, and fine-grained and coarse-grained parallel tasks by choosing a concurrent program structure and parallelizing the workload optimally. You will also learn how to use task parallel library, cancellations, timeouts, and how to handle errors. You will know how to choose the appropriate data structure for a specific parallel algorithm to achieve scalability and performance. Further, you'll learn about server scalability, asynchronous I/O, and thread pools, and write responsive traditional Windows and Windows Store applications. By the end of the book, you will be able to diagnose and resolve typical problems that could happen in multithreaded applications. Style and approach An easy-to-follow, example-based guide that will walk you through the core principles of concurrency and multithreading using C#.

Free Delivery
Pinterest Twitter Facebook Google+
You may like...
Intimate Relationships and Social Change…
Christina L. Scott, Sampson Blair Hardcover R3,129 Discovery Miles 31 290
Thankfulness: A Colouring Book
Lizzie Preston Paperback R264 Discovery Miles 2 640
Modern Woodcuts and Lithographs by…
C. Geoffrey (Charles Geoffrey) Holme, Malcolm C. (Malcolm Charles) Salaman Hardcover R832 Discovery Miles 8 320
Next Beautiful Blossoms - Grayscale…
Lech Balcerzak Paperback R397 Discovery Miles 3 970
Print Index - A Guide to Reproductions
Kathe Chipman Hardcover R2,224 Discovery Miles 22 240
Be A Triangle - How I Went From Being…
Lilly Singh Hardcover R385 R349 Discovery Miles 3 490
Afrikaner Identity - Dysfunction And…
Yves Vanderhaeghen Paperback R551 Discovery Miles 5 510
A Few Days in Athens - Being the…
Frances Wright Paperback R420 Discovery Miles 4 200
Boereverneukers - Afrikaanse…
Izak du Plessis Paperback  (1)
R245 Discovery Miles 2 450
Legalizing Prostitution - From Illicit…
Ronald Weitzer Paperback R758 Discovery Miles 7 580

 

Partners